MGCP Configuration

The MGCP (Media Gateway Control Protocol) is an interface protocol
used in the next generation network for the control interface
generated after separation of media processing from signaling
control, that is, the interface between the MG (Media Gateway) and
the CA (Call Agent).
1. Click the VOIP button on the WEB page to enter the VOIP
configuration page.
2. Click the General link on the left part of the page to enter
the General configuration page for VOIP.
3. Select MGCP from the Signaling protocol box.
4. Click the Apply button to finish the MGCP protocol
selection.
